Award in Artificial Intelligence

Fully Online
1 month
150 hours
EQF6
48,000 KES
About

About this degree

Artificial Intelligence (AI) aims to teach students the techniques for building computer systems that exhibit intelligent behavior. AI is one of the most consequential applications of computer science, and is helping to solve complex real-world problems, from self-driving cars to facial recognition. This course will teach students the theory and techniques of AI, so that they understand how AI methods work under a variety of conditions. The course begins with an exploration of the historical development of AI, and helps students understand the key problems that are studied and the key ideas that have emerged from research. Then, students learn a set of methods that cover: problem solving, search algorithms, knowledge representation and reasoning, natural language understanding, and computer vision. Throughout the course, as they apply technical methods, students will also examine pressing ethical concerns that are resulting from AI, including privacy and surveillance, transparency, bias, and more. Course assignments will consist of short programming exercises and discussion- oriented readings. The course culminates in a final group project and accompanying paper that allows students to apply concepts to a problem of personal interet.